Particular, proposed recovery sound waves are sent out deep in a regular or pulsating pattern right into the tissues when the transducer is rotated circularly over the damaged area. Light warmth is produced as the acoustic waves pass through the cells, raising blood flow in the location. The low strength makes sure very little home heating, making it secure for even more fragile or delicate areas while still experiencing the healing capacity of ultrasound waves treatment. This ultrasound treatment technique is commonly used in physical rehabilitation and recovery settings to promote cells recovery, boost blood flow, and alleviate pain. in different bone and joint problems, such as neck and back pain, arm joint injuries, knee sprains and more. The main goal of ultrasound treatment is to increase quick soft tissue healing, increase blood circulation, and alleviate discomfort in targeted areas. Restorative Applications Of Ultrasound

Longitudinal waves are the most vital for ultrasound medical applications [14]; the impacts and the devices of their generation are laid out in Table 2. The amplitude and strength of the wave decreases with distance at a price of around 0.5 dB cm − 1 MHz − 1; for a 3.5 MHz wave, the amplitude will be reduced by one-half, and the intensity by an aspect of 4 (− 6 dB) after traveling around 4 cm [14] Sonictens, an advanced pain-relieving modern technology created by UltraCare PRO, has actually been integrated right into a tiny, smooth tool.
